Quality Control Supervisor
StafflinkBrampton, ON- Full-time
Job Description
Position Summary : This role requires expertise in quality inspection processes, problem-solving, and a proactive approach to driving continuous improvement. The successful candidate will collaborate across departments to resolve quality issues and maintain high-quality standards throughout production. Primary / Essential Responsibilities :
Supervise the quality control team responsible for incoming, in-process, and final inspections, ensuring strict adherence to company quality standards and procedures.
Oversee and evaluate inspection results, addressing any discrepancies and recommending corrective actions to maintain product quality.
Ensure that all inspection equipment and tools are properly maintained, calibrated, and in working order to meet production requirements.
Collaborate with production teams to understand quality issues and assist in root cause analysis and resolution of quality problems.
Implement, lead, and continuously improve quality control procedures, including developing and maintaining work instructions and inspection protocols.
Provide regular feedback and performance evaluations for the quality control team; guide, mentor, and develop team members to ensure high performance and skill development.
Monitor and report on quality metrics such as defect rates, non-conformance, and corrective actions.
Work closely with the production team to minimize quality defects and delays, ensuring that production schedules are met without compromising quality.
Manage and control quality audits, inspections, and compliance checks, ensuring that all regulatory and industry standards are met.
Lead continuous improvement initiatives using tools like lean manufacturing principles, Six Sigma, or other quality improvement methodologies.
Respond to customer complaints or quality-related issues, working cross-functionally to resolve issues and improve overall quality.
Maintain accurate records of inspections, tests, and quality reports, ensuring traceability and documentation are compliant with internal and external audits.
Assist in the development of training programs to ensure the quality team and production staff are well-versed in quality standards, procedures, and regulations.
Ensure all health, safety, and environmental regulations are adhered to during quality inspections.
Required Qualifications :
Experience : 5+ years of progressive quality control experience in a manufacturing environment.
Leadership : Proven experience supervising and leading a team, with a focus on performance management, coaching, and development.
Education : High school diploma or GED; a Bachelor's degree in a related field is preferred.
Skills :
Strong knowledge of quality control techniques and tools (e.g., SPC, root cause analysis, failure analysis).
Proficient in using quality inspection tools and equipment (e.g., calipers, micrometers, gauges).
Strong problem-solving, analytical, and decision-making skills.
Advanced knowledge of MS Office Suite (Excel, Word, PowerPoint); experience with ERP and inventory management systems is a plus.
Ability to read and interpret blueprints, technical drawings, and specifications.
Other : Strong attention to detail and a hands-on approach to ensuring quality standards are met throughout production.
Certifications : Six Sigma, Lean Manufacturing, or ISO 9001 certifications are a plus.
Skills : High energy with a proactive, results-driven approach to problem-solving.
Experience : Experience in working with electromechanical systems or plant operations.
Leadership Style : Strong communicator with the ability to motivate, train, and develop team members.
Aptitude : Ability to manage multiple tasks, work under pressure, and meet deadlines.
